Transaction 5d17d0cc823abed27b88104145e13b6a34a90956e0ead02f5c43f58b16592553
1 Input
1 Output
-
5d17d0cc823abed27b88104145e13b6a34a90956e0ead02f5c43f58b16592553:0
- value
- 840284
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f5d17e72cab6c7341c63639a39a5ed9f5ca2e774 OP_EQUAL
- address
- 3Q6nSSFtNoqR5Lh96iCb995vCRKA59F4WK